  • Applications

    Dichloroacetylene (CAS 7572-29-4) is primarily used as a reactive building block in organic synthesis, serving as a precursor to chlorinated acetylene derivatives and to higher-order polyyne scaffolds. In industrial settings it is commonly evaluated for producing specialty intermediates for polymers and materials science, including halogenated monomers and crosslinking reagents. It may be used as a starting material in electronics or coatings/inks research for the synthesis of organochlorinated alkyne compounds. It is also employed in exploratory laboratory work and in developing pharmaceutical or agrochemical intermediates under strictly controlled conditions. Handling is specialized due to volatility and reactivity, and use is subject to local regulations and formulation limits.
